Hail & Storm Damage Repair questions from Perdido Key drivers
Does a hail claim raise my insurance rates?
Hail and storm damage falls under comprehensive coverage — a not-at-fault claim type that insurers treat differently from collisions. Every policy differs, so confirm with your agent, but comprehensive claims generally don't carry the same rate impact as at-fault accidents.
A hurricane is forecast — should I wait until after to fix existing damage?
Fix pre-existing damage before a storm if you can: mixing old and new damage complicates claims. After a storm, document everything with photos immediately and contact us early — repair queues fill fast across the Gulf Coast.
